Abstract
- Fake news is being disseminated rapidly and it is discussed constantly on social media through "likes", sharing and comments. Fake news undermined the contribution of media and gives space to powerful institution and specific parties to promote their policies as given. In this paper, I discuss that in order to understand in depth the fake news/disinformation, a phenomenon that threats democracy, each citizen should have the ability to connect the context, the words, the image and the extralinguistic features in order to "read" behind the lines and identify the intentions that are hidden. To support this claim, a specific excerpt from fake news by Donald Trump is being analysed thoroughly with the combination of Critical Discourse Analysis (CDA) and Social Semiotics (SS). From the analysis it is shown that not fake news merely, but rather elaborated myths are being constructed which attribute characteristics in social groups, in order to serve specific goals.
